Nestled within the heart of Atlanta, the Swan House at the Atlanta History Center is one of the most iconic wedding venues in the South. With its grand staircases, European-inspired architecture, sweeping lawns, and historic charm, it offers an effortlessly elegant backdrop for couples seeking a refined, elevated wedding experience.

One of my favorite parts of photographing weddings at Swan House is how versatile the venue is visually. Every corner feels intentional and artful. From the dramatic spiral staircases inside the mansion to the iconic black-and-white checkered floors and sweeping exterior staircases, the venue naturally lends itself to both editorial portraits and authentic documentary moments.
